Factors to Consider When Choosing Splitscreen Video Baby Monitors

Choosing the right splitscreen video baby monitor involves understanding several key factors that influence daily use and long-term satisfaction. Beyond basic features, considering your specific needs, security concerns, and budget can help narrow down options to the best fit for your family.

Display Size and Resolution

The clarity and size of the display significantly impact how well you can see your baby or children. Larger screens with higher resolution, such as 7-inch HD monitors, provide sharper images and easier viewing from a distance. However, larger displays can also mean a bulkier device and sometimes higher cost. Balance your space and visual clarity needs, especially if you plan to monitor multiple rooms or children simultaneously.

Battery Life and Power Options

Long battery life reduces the need for frequent recharging, which is especially helpful during overnight use or long days. Models with 30 hours of battery life, like some HelloBaby options, can operate throughout the day without interruption. Consider whether a monitor has rechargeable batteries, replaceable batteries, or a power cord, and think about your typical use pattern to choose the best setup.

Connectivity and Security

WiFi-enabled monitors often include remote access, app control, and smart features, but they also pose security risks if not properly protected. Non-WiFi models, which use FHSS or other secure protocols, provide a more private option, often with longer battery life. Decide whether remote access or security is a higher priority for your household, and weigh the convenience against potential vulnerabilities.

Additional Features and Versatility

Features like pan-tilt-zoom, temperature sensors, night vision, and two-way audio add convenience and peace of mind. These extras, however, can increase cost and complexity. For busy households with multiple children or larger spaces, features like remote pan-tilt-zoom can be game-changing. But if simplicity and affordability are your main goals, focus on core video and audio functions.

Ease of Setup and Use

Ease of installation varies, with some models offering plug-and-play setups and others requiring more technical steps. Monitors with intuitive interfaces, straightforward pairing, and minimal setup time reduce frustration, especially for less tech-savvy users. Consider whether the monitor’s controls and app interface are user-friendly, as this impacts daily convenience and ongoing satisfaction.

Price and Overall Value

Balancing features against cost is key. Higher-priced models often include superior video quality, longer battery life, and extra features, but may not be necessary for all families. Conversely, budget options might omit some bells and whistles but still provide reliable monitoring. Prioritize what features matter most to you and look for a model that offers the best value within your budget range.

Frequently Asked Questions

Are WiFi baby monitors more secure than non-WiFi options?

WiFi baby monitors offer the advantage of remote access through apps, enabling parents to check on their children from anywhere. However, they can also pose security risks if not properly protected with strong passwords and network security measures. Non-WiFi models typically use secure radio frequencies like FHSS, reducing hacking concerns but lacking remote viewing capabilities. Your choice should balance convenience with your comfort level regarding security.

How important is battery life for a splitscreen baby monitor?

Battery life is a vital factor because it determines how long the monitor can operate without recharge or power connection. For overnight monitoring or long outings, a model with 30-hour battery life can be a significant advantage, reducing interruptions. Shorter battery life means more frequent charging, which can be inconvenient, especially if you forget to recharge regularly. Consider your daily routine to decide the appropriate battery capacity.

Should I prioritize a larger display or more features?

A larger display makes it easier to see your children clearly, especially in low light, but may come with a higher cost and bulkier device. Additional features like pan-tilt-zoom, temperature sensors, and night vision add versatility but also complexity and expense. Think about your primary needs—if clear visuals are your priority, opt for a bigger, high-resolution screen. For added functionality, choose a model with the features that best match your lifestyle.

Are split-screen monitors better than single-camera units?

Split-screen monitors excel in situations where you need to keep track of multiple rooms or children simultaneously, providing a comprehensive view at a glance. However, they often come at a higher price point and may have smaller individual camera feeds compared to single-camera monitors. If monitoring just one room or child, a dedicated single-camera monitor might be simpler and more cost-effective.

What should I consider regarding setup and ease of use?

Ease of setup ensures you won’t spend hours installing or troubleshooting your monitor. Look for models with straightforward instructions, minimal wiring, and intuitive controls. User-friendly interfaces, clear menus, and reliable app connectivity make daily use hassle-free. Investing in a monitor that’s easy to operate can save time and reduce frustration, especially during busy or stressful moments.
